Cyber Insurance Industry Overview
Segments
- By Type: The global cyber insurance market can be segmented into standalone cyber insurance and packaged cyber insurance. Standalone cyber insurance provides coverage specifically for cyber-related incidents, while packaged cyber insurance is bundled with other insurances such as property or general liability policies.
- By Coverage: This segment includes first-party coverage (covering direct losses to the insured party) and third-party coverage (covering liabilities to external parties). First-party coverage may include expenses related to data breaches, ransomware attacks, or business interruption, while third-party coverage may include legal fees, settlements, or regulatory fines.
- By Organization Size: The market can also be segmented based on the size of the organization purchasing cyber insurance. This includes small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) and large enterprises. SMEs are increasingly recognizing the importance of cyber insurance to protect their business from financial losses due to cyber incidents.

The global cyber insurance market is witnessing a surge in demand as businesses across various industries are increasingly recognizing the critical need for protection against cyber threats and data breaches. One emerging trend in the market is the shift towards more customized and flexible cyber insurance policies that cater to the specific needs and risk profiles of organizations. Companies are looking for comprehensive coverage that goes beyond traditional data breach protection to include services such as incident response, business interruption coverage, and regulatory defense expenses. This trend indicates a growing maturity in the market as insurers evolve their offerings to keep pace with the rapidly changing cyber threat landscape.
Another key development in the cyber insurance market is the rising adoption of cyber insurance among small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). Previously considered a niche product primarily for large enterprises, cyber insurance is now being recognized as essential for businesses of all sizes. SMEs are increasingly becoming targets of cyber attacks due to their perceived vulnerabilities, making cyber insurance a vital component of their risk management strategy. Insurers are responding to this trend by developing specialized products tailored to the unique needs and budget constraints of SMEs, thereby expanding the overall market reach and penetration.
Moreover, with the proliferation of Internet of Things (IoT) devices and an increasingly interconnected digital ecosystem, the scope of cyber risks faced by organizations is expanding. As a result, there is a growing emphasis on proactive risk management and cybersecurity measures to prevent and mitigate potential cyber threats. Insurers are not only providing financial protection through cyber insurance but also offering risk assessment, cybersecurity consulting, and incident response services to help clients strengthen their cyber resilience. This integrated approach to cyber risk management is reshaping the insurance industry, fostering closer collaboration between insurers, cybersecurity firms, and businesses to build a more robust defense against cyber threats.
In conclusion, the global cyber insurance market is experiencing dynamic growth driven by the evolving nature of cyber risks, increased awareness among businesses of all sizes, and the development of more sophisticated insurance products and services. As organizations continue to grapple with the escalating threat of cyber attacks, the demand for comprehensive cyber insurance coverage is expected to rise.
